This role is for a Customer Program Manager focused on executive briefings at an AI company. The primary responsibility is to design, manage, and scale the executive briefing program to facilitate engagement between senior leaders from strategic customers and Anthropic's spokespeople, product, and research teams. The role involves end-to-end program ownership, including qualification, agenda design, execution, and post-briefing follow-through, working closely with GTM, Product Marketing, Solutions, and executive leadership. The goal is to use briefings to advance customer opportunities and influence pipeline.

What you'd actually do

  1. Define and own the Executive Briefing program: briefing formats, qualification criteria, the request-and-intake process from Sales, capacity planning, calendar, and operating SLAs.
  2. Govern which strategic accounts and executives receive a briefing each quarter in partnership with GTM leadership; hold the qualification bar and proactively surface accounts that should be engaged.
  3. Lead discovery with account teams ahead of each briefing to understand the customer's objectives, business context, and where they are in their evaluation, and translate that into a tailored agenda.
  4. Own agenda design and co-own agenda development with Product Marketing for every briefing. Shape the narrative arc and discussion topics to the customer's objectives, select discussion leaders and demos, and partner with PMM to build the briefing-specific content.
  5. Build and manage the speaker bench: maintain the roster, match speakers to briefings, run prep, and manage capacity so no one is over-asked.
